Did you know? 2-1-1 is a 24/7 helpline that connects you to essential health and human services when you need them most! Whether it’s support, resources, or emergency services, a community resource specialist is just a call away to connect you with local organizations that can improve and even save lives. Our Story and History United Way of Lackawanna Wayne Pike Counties plays a unique role in the community as a leader in the health and human services sector. We firmly believe that to successfully carry out our organizational vision and mission UWLWC must be committed to diversity. United we will Together we tackle the problems most people shy away from by forging unlikely partnerships finding new solutions to old problems mobilizing the best resources and inspiring individuals like you to join us in the fight against our communitys most daunting social crises. Ways to Help Together we will advocate for children families veterans older adults and those facing illness or disability.
